How to Manifest Your Desires
Get the idea of the fulfilled desire settled within your mind and it must manifest in physical reality.
Manifestation works on the premise that the outer world is a reflection of your inner state of consciousness, that imagining creates your personal reality, and that by deliberately imagining your desire as already an accomplished fact and accepting the reality of what you have done, you can bring it into physical manifestation.
The Process
Experience the fulfilled desire in imagination. When you have a clear idea of what you want to manifest, imagine a short clip of that desired reality, experiencing some little scene that implies your desire has already manifested. Do this with the intention it manifest. This is an act of appropriating the thing desired; it is “giving it to yourself in consciousness”. Once you have appropriated it, it is yours. Do not give it back. The key is to experience it in imagination as though it were really happening in the moment. This shows your subconscious mind what the outcome should be like, as opposed to merely telling it. Once you have experienced it in imagination, consider it a done deal.
Refuse to entertain the possibility of alternative, contradictory outcomes. The mind is very accustomed with the old story, so it is normal for thoughts to arise that do not align with your fulfilled desire. Refuse to entertain them as truth or as possibility. Instead, remind yourself of your imaginal scene and of the infallibility of the Law and that your fulfilled desire is the new truth and must manifest. Persist in retraining your thought until the new idea becomes the natural way of thinking about the subject matter.
Imagining creates reality. Imagine your wish-fulfilled. Decide it is manifesting. Remain steadfast in this decision.
